I'v up graded my antenna system from a longwire antenna to a broad band Hexbeam 6x bands,
Its mounted on a British ex-mod�Clark SCAM mast (Self Contained Army Mast) is a model of pneumatically-raised telescopic mast of 8 sections manufacturerd by Clark Mast Systems.
The hex beam antenna sits well on the scam mast in the lowered position it's just �3meters 600mm 11feet to the top of the antenna
,
When the masts up and elevated it's over 12 meters 40feet in height, �SCAM masts are not light weight! At over 95kg, but two people can move it around you attach the legs,just pump it up and of you go if you lock each section of as you go there is no need to keep the pump attached then stays up forever.
Near the base of the scam is a bearing which the whole mast can rotate,with compass degrees on it so it's easily turned to point the antenna to the right direction no need for rotor.
